原文:ASP.NET Core 中的缓存

目录 缓存的基本概念 缓存原理 缓存设计 分布式缓存 Memcache 与 Redis 的比较 缓存穿透,缓存击穿,缓存雪崩解决方案 数据一致性 使用内置 MemoryCache 使用分布式缓存 Redis 使用 Stackexchange.Redis 自己封装一个 RedisHelper 类 参考 缓存的基本概念 缓存是分布式系统中的重要组件,主要解决高并发,大数据场景下,热点数据访问的性能问 ...

2018-08-14 15:10 4 850 推荐指数:

查看详情

ASP.NET Core 缓存 / MemoryCache

十年河东,十年河西,莫欺少年穷 学无止境,精益求精 ASP.NET Core 缓存Caching,.NET Core 为我们提供了Caching 的组件。 目前Caching 组件提供了三种存储方式。 Memory Redis SqlServer 学习在ASP.NET Core ...

Tue Jun 30 04:22:00 CST 2020 0 1446
ASP.NET Core的Http缓存

ASP.NET Core的Http缓存 Http响应缓存可减少客户端或代理对web服务器发出的请求数。响应缓存还减少了web服务器生成响应所需的工作量。响应缓存由Http请求的header控制。 而ASP.NET Core对其都有相应的实现,并不需要了解里面的工作细节,即可对其进行良好 ...

Sun Mar 08 06:00:00 CST 2020 0 1694
ASP.NET Core缓存[1]:如何在一个ASP.NET Core应用中使用缓存

.NET Core针对缓存提供了很好的支持 ,我们不仅可以选择将数据缓存在应用进程自身的内存,还可以采用分布式的形式将缓存数据存储在一个“中心数据库”。对于分布式缓存,.NET Core提供了针对Redis和SQL Server的原生支持。除了这个独立的缓存系统之外,ASP.NET Core ...

Mon Feb 13 05:52:00 CST 2017 11 6110
ASP.NET Core缓存静态资源

背景 缓存样式表,JavaScript或图像文件等静态资源可以提高您网站的性能。在客户端,总是从缓存中加载一个静态文件,这样可以减少对服务器的请求数量,从而减少获取页面及其资源的时间。在服务器端,由于它们的请求较少,服务器可以处理更多的客户端而无需升级硬件。 虽然缓存是一件好事,但您必须确保 ...

Tue Nov 21 18:46:00 CST 2017 4 2033
asp.net core 2.1 缓存和Session

缓存 缓存在内存 ASP.NET Core 使用 IMemoryCache内存缓存是使用依赖关系注入从应用引用的服务。 请在ConfigureServices调用AddMemoryCache(): 在构造函数请求 IMemoryCache实例: 资料:https ...

Mon Dec 03 08:05:00 CST 2018 2 674
Asp.net Core 缓存 MemoryCache 和 Redis

Asp.net Core 缓存 MemoryCache 和 Redis 目录索引  【无私分享:ASP.NET CORE 项目实战】目录索引 简介      经过 N 久反复的尝试,翻阅了网上无数的资料,GitHub上下载了十几个源码参考, Memory 和 Redis ...

Thu Aug 25 15:39:00 CST 2016 2 7863
ASP.NET Core 开发-缓存(Caching)

ASP.NET Core 缓存Caching,.NET Core 为我们提供了Caching 的组件。 目前Caching 组件提供了三种存储方式。 Memory Redis SqlServer 学习在ASP.NET Core 中使用Caching。 Memory Caching ...

Fri Jun 17 01:18:00 CST 2016 6 12281
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M